Non-Profit Organization Finances and Pricing

Non-Profit Organization Finances and setThe world(prenominal) Alliance for TB Drug Development (TB Alliance) is a non-profit system of rules which uses its revenues to develop untested, simpler, faster-acting TB drug regimens1 rather than distributing those profits to its shareholders and lineup of directors.2 It is also a PDP (product development partnership) that operates like a biotechnology firm creating collabo balancens between the cliquish, public, academic, and philanthropic fields to twit the development of new TB drugs for developing countries using various(a) licensing and partnership agreements. In this way take chances and incentives are shared between the partners. TB Alliance manages the various projects although the laboratory experiments and clinical studies are performed by external partners. Donors include offstage foundations, g everywherenments, multilateral conferrers including the Bill Melinda Gates Foundation, the European Commission, the Global H ealth ripe Technology Fund, Irish Fund, National Institute of Allergy and Infectious Disease, UK AID, UNIT AID, United States Agency for external Development, and the US Food and Drug Administ symmetryn.3 As a corporation, TB Alliance has to maintain legal stipulation and reporting functions by filing reports with federal, state and local authorities. However, they have to demonstrate no profit and picture how the money was utilized by submitting a Form 990 to the Internal Revenue Service (IRS) to keep their tax-free status.4 The monetary get for non-profit research base physical composition is important because it is funded by various donors. The control board of directors and focal point of TB Alliance are accountable for how the money is spent for research, administrative activities, and production of new, faster-acting and affordable TB drugs.Ratios to Mea certain(prenominal)(a) the Financial Position of an Organization An efficient measure which could analyse the tre nds and fiscal position of the organization over a period of time is the ratio abbreviation. Ratio analysis is a gauge which indicates the organisational financial performance.5 Management of a non-profit organization uses ratio analysis in order to highlight the flaws and strengths of various strategies on the basis of which plans could be shaped. We also make sure that any grant or investment we give is not a huge percentage of their annual budget.9There are eleven ratios identified by Non Profit Assistance Fund which could be apply by a non-profit research ground organization which is funded by private donors.10There are 5 Balance sheet ratios which could be used by a non-profit organizationDebt ratio It is used to dig into how much organization is relying on other people debts and how much cushion there is for the company. It is calculated by dividing summate debt to centre net assets.11Current ratio Current ratio is current assets to current liabilities and it identifies the mightiness of the organization to pay its debts on time. It is a measure which tells about the cash flow in burn up future.12Days cash on hand It is cash and current investments to daily cash requirement and helps to fall upon the amount of operating cast required by organization. It is right-hand as it tells about the unrestricted cash available to the organization.13Accounts receivable aging Account receivable aging ratio is important because it helps to let on all those bills which have become older and are aberrant. This ratio identifies the cash flow problems of the non profit organization. It consists of all the accounts account payable overdue for more than 90 days to total accounts receivable.14Accounts payable aging It is all the accounts payable over due for more than 90 days to total accounts payable. It specifies the cash flows problems related to payments and serve as a tool for several financial problems.15There are 3 expense ratios which are important for a non-profit organization as donors will need to examine the expense incurred and these arePersonnel salutes ratio It indicates the expense incurred on the human resource of the organization and tells how much budget is allocated for staff. It is the total wages to total expense.16Administration live ratio It is the total general and administrative expense to total expense. It is very helpful for the donors who regularly examine the expenses of company over time.17Fundraising efficiency It is the income contributed to fundraising expense. As the organization raise funds from private donors its important to know each dollar which is being raised from the contribution by subject expense on fundraising.18There is 1 ratio related to income statement Reliance ratio. This ratio helps to identify the major source of income which is utilized by the organization for income. The nature of provider in the contract is advisory and can only give suggestions to the board of non profit research company and the ultimate decision lies with management.21Contracts can be (1) Fixed expenditure contract when there is no uncertainty in the scope of work. The contractor is bound to complete the task at heart the hold amount of money and time and is required to finish the task within a determined amount. In this type of contract, the contractor bears the risk and the s cope needs to be as detailed as possible22 (2) Cost reimbursable contract where the contractor is reimbursed for completed work and paid a certain amount representing the profit. In this type of contract, the buyer bears the risk since the buyer pays for all (allowable and reasonable) tolls incurred by the contractor23 (3) snip and Materials contract when a contractor is paid on the basis of court of labor specified hourly, actual cost of materials and equipment used, and an agreed upon amount to cover the contractors overhead with instructions not to exceed a certain limit. Here the risk is distributed between both buyer and seller24.Pricing Policy and Costing Methods Price is the abide by charged for a product and price policy is the strategy by which the wholesale or retail price of the product is stubborn.25 In developed countries the price of product is high due to high cost of RD as compared to underdeveloped countries.26 Various costing methods which could be used by org anization are cost based, competition based and value based pricing. Cost based pricing is the price of product decided according to the cost plus a profit margin. Cost based pricing consider both the fixed plus variable cost of the product and adds a margin over it.27 Competition based pricing is a pricing technique that considers the industry in which the firm is operating and the competition.28 Finally, Value based pricing is the customer based pricing technique which is based on customers needs, habits and attitudes.29 The pricing structure for a non-profit pharmaceutical company providing inexpensive drugs is cost based pricing method which includes the fixed and variable cost plus an addition of suitable profit margin to cover the expenses for instance Howard Hugh medical institute uses cost based pricing. 30 The company can also use three tiered pricing policy in which it could make the pricing strategies by dividing countries into groups.
